New 2026 Porsche 911 Cup 992.2 Is Faster Than Ever
The 2026 Porsche 911 Cup 992.2 represents one of the most important updates in Porsche’s customer racing program, and it shows how the brand continues to refine a formula that has worked for decades. At first glance, it might look similar to the previous Cup car, but once you understand what has changed, you start to see how much effort went into making it faster, more consistent, and easier for drivers to push at the limit.
Under the rear decklid sits a 4.0 liter naturally aspirated flat six engine producing around 520 horsepower. There is no turbocharging here, no hybrid assistance, just pure mechanical performance. That is exactly what makes this car so special. The power delivery is sharp, immediate, and predictable, which is critical in a racing environment where drivers need confidence corner after corner. The engine revs to around 8400 revolutions per minute, delivering a sound and feel that connects directly with Porsche’s racing heritage.
Power is sent to the rear wheels through a 6 speed sequential gearbox. Every shift is quick and precise, designed to minimize time lost between gears. This is not about comfort, it is about efficiency and performance. Combined with a lightweight body that comes in at approximately 1288 kilograms, the car feels incredibly responsive. Every input from the driver translates instantly to movement on track.
One of the biggest upgrades with the 992.2 generation is found in the chassis and suspension. Porsche has continued using a double wishbone front suspension setup inspired by its top tier race cars. This provides better control during high speed cornering and improves front end grip. The rear multi link setup complements this by maintaining stability under acceleration. Together, the balance of the car feels more predictable, especially during long stints where tire management becomes crucial.
Braking performance has also been improved. The car uses 380 millimeter steel brake discs paired with a motorsport grade anti lock braking system. This system has been refined to offer better modulation, allowing drivers to brake later and with more confidence. In a one make series where every car is nearly identical, these small improvements can make a noticeable difference over a race distance.
Aerodynamics play a major role as well. The updated front end design improves airflow and increases downforce, while the large rear wing keeps the car planted at high speeds. The goal here is not just maximum grip, but consistency. Porsche engineers focused on making the car stable in a wide range of conditions so that drivers can push harder without unexpected behavior.
Inside the cockpit, everything is stripped down to the essentials. There is a single racing seat, a full roll cage, and a multifunction steering wheel packed with controls. Every switch has a purpose. Even though it is a race car, some versions include air conditioning to help drivers stay focused during longer races. It is a reminder that endurance and comfort still matter when performance is on the line.
What really makes the 2026 Porsche 911 Cup 992.2 stand out is its role in motorsport. This is the car used in Porsche Supercup and Carrera Cup championships around the world. It is often the first step for drivers aiming to reach higher levels of racing. Because every car is built to the same specification, the focus shifts entirely to driver skill. That creates incredibly close racing and makes the series exciting to watch.
